
Qatar
naukrigulf.com - 24 days ago
Oman
naukrigulf.com - 24 days ago
Oman
naukrigulf.com - 24 days ago
Kuwait
naukrigulf.com - 24 days ago
Kuwait
naukrigulf.com - 24 days ago
Kuwait
naukrigulf.com - 24 days ago
Bahrain
naukrigulf.com - 24 days ago
Al Khobar, Saudi Arabia
naukrigulf.com - 24 days ago
Saudi Arabia
naukrigulf.com - 24 days ago
Saudi Arabia
naukrigulf.com - 24 days ago